none
Как преобразовать Declined обновления в Unapproved RRS feed

  • Общие обсуждения

  • Добрый день,

    На сервере WSUS есть несколько тысяч отмененных (Declined) обновлений. Нужно, чтобы их заново обработало правило Automatic Approvals.

    Проблема в том, что для этого эти обновления надо предварительно пометить как Unapproved. Изучив вопрос, я понял, что WSUS не имеет такого штатного функционала через GUI.

    Используя информацию с сайта https://devblogs.microsoft.com/scripting/approve-or-decline-wsus-updates-by-using-powershell/ попытался убрать отметку Declined с обновлений через PowerShell:

    #Подключаемся к WSUS серверу
    $wsusserver = 'wsus'
    #Load required assemblies
    [void][reflection.assembly]::LoadWithPartialName("Microsoft.UpdateServices.Administration")
    $wsus = [Microsoft.UpdateServices.Administration.AdminProxy]::getUpdateServer($wsusserver,$False,"8530")
    
    #Получаем обновления с сервера
    $updates = $wsus.GetUpdates()
    
    #Меняем свойство каждого обновления
    ForEach ($update in $updates) 
    {
        $update.IsDeclined=$False
    }

    Консоль PowerShell показала, что обновления теперь не являются IsDeclined, но через GUI ни чего не поменялось.

    Подскажите, пожалуйста, где моя ошибка? Есть ли способ преобразовать обновления в Unapproved?

    3 августа 2019 г. 17:24

Все ответы

  • Как это GUI не имеет такого функционала?

    Кликаешь правой кнопкой мыши по отклоненному обновлению (несколькими обновлениям) и выбираешь "Утвердить". В новом окошке открываешь выпадающий список слева от нужной группы и выбираешь сначала "Утверждено для установки", а затем "Не утверждено". При необходимости, там же выбираешь еще и "Применить к дочерним". И только после этого кликаешь "ОК".

    Думаю, с английскими аналогами разберешься ;-)

    4 сентября 2019 г. 11:57
  • лучше всего выбрать все обновления по фильтру "declined", затем в списке отмененных обновлений включить отображение столбца "supersedence", отсортировать обновления по данному столбцу и перевести в состояние "not approved" все обновления, у которых:

    1.поле "supersedense" имеется значок "синий квадрат вверху" или без значка

    и

    2. тип обновления "critical update" или "security update"

    После того, как ПК отчитаются, данные обновления можно будет подтвердить для установки на ПК.

    16 сентября 2019 г. 11:41